Transaction

8405c1707e07df0c043d9cc45a13542fa0a4ec79febf5958cec1d5d8f8512b1c
275,629 confirmations
Timestamp
1609100110
Block663,244
Fee18,302 sats
Fee rate136.6 sats/vB
view on mempool.space

Inputs & Outputs